The Wilder Sisters

The Wilder sisters fall in love with men when they least expect it—and most need it. Rose, the older, more practical one, is a widow who lives in New Mexico and has two ungrateful kids, a bored dog, and a horse with a bad back. Lily, the younger, more daring sister, lives in Southern California, where she has put her career before everything else—including love. Lily and Rose flee to their parents’ ranch, for some emotional detox. But the two haven’t spoken in five long years, and spending time togther is the last thing they’d planned on. Nor had either anticipated being so actively pusued by lovestruck men. Readers will be in their corner all the way as they rediscover the bonds of sisterhood and slowly open their hearts to love.

Skies of Fire

Yellowstone meets The Day After Tomorrow in this gripping geological suspense about two people consumed by a decade of grudges, forced to survive a crumbling, angry Earth.

When an asteroid knocks the moon off its axis, scientists predict Earth’s eventual destruction. But years pass with life mostly unchanged—until volcanoes erupt, wildfires spread, and sinkholes swallow entire cities.

And the cruelest twist? You have to survive the apocalypse with the person who destroyed your family long before the world began to burn.

Ten years ago, Ava’s uncle took everything from the Bennett family, leaving both her and Knox orphaned and branded by a tragedy neither could control. She spent the decade as the town pariah while Knox perfected the art of avoiding her because befriending her felt like a betrayal to his grief.

As the world fractures around them, Ava’s blackout spells worsen and Knox’s father disappears before fate delivers a final cruel twist: they need each other to survive. And when tomorrow isn’t guaranteed, and the earth is hell-bent on destroying everything, some grudges are worth dying for… and some love is worth defying the end of the world.

From the author of The Ending Series and Savage North Chronicles comes Skies of Fire, a cli-fi adventure about forging a future when everything feels broken, and discovering that love can heal even the deepest wounds.

Rise of the Zombies

A failed biological attack ravaged the population of the world.
Millions dead, and millions more turned into feral creatures that spend their time hunting down survivors who are desperately trying to rebuild society and make a life for themselves.

Several years have passed since the majority of the infected population suddenly dropped out of sight.
With the threat seemingly abated, Hunter Ashcroft and other survivors begin to branch out in an effort to find other pockets of civilization.
During an expedition to explore the remnants of Nashville, Tennessee, they are surprised to find a thriving community of survivors.
College student turned scientist, Rachel Benchley is among the survivors. Her experiments on the infected revealed a possible explanation for their sudden mass disappearance years earlier. Instead of dying off as a result of the virus, they were evolving.

While popular fiction has many theories about how a zombie plague could descend upon the earth, those theories were easily discounted as just stories. Now, the survivors must prepare themselves as those stories to become reality as the dead return to life and stalk humans for a nourishing enzyme that will keep them alive.
It doesn’t take Hunter and his people long to learn while it appears on the surface that this sheltered colony have done remarkably well for themselves in this post-apocalyptic world, something sinister has been brewing within their ranks that even their own people were not aware of. As if the threat of a brewing zombie outbreak were not enough, they learn that their own kind is willing to sell their souls to the devil if that’s what it takes to ensure their survival.

By Hook & Crook

What if robbing a vault earned you a standing ovation?

In the city of Azoria, heists are a sanctioned sport, a dazzling spectacle where only the boldest thieves thrive. And Lars Harrow is the best.

But Lars wants more than fame. He wants the heist that will cement his legacy and put him beyond the reach of the city’s power brokers. When a shadowy patron offers him a job targeting Cecil Thume—the ruthless mastermind who controls every theft in Azoria—Lars sees his shot at something bigger.

Yet the deeper he digs, the more dangerous the game becomes. A brutal murder sends a clear message: Thume isn’t just profiting from the city’s underworld… he is the underworld. And he’ll do whatever it takes to keep control.

As the line between thief and pawn blurs, Lars must decide how much he’s willing to risk. The city, his crew, and his own future hang in the balance.

If you enjoyed books like Six of Crows, Mistborn, or The Lies of Locke Lamora, you won’t be able to put down this electrifying tale of ambition, greed, betrayal, and redemption.
